What You'll Do 

  • Perform dental prophylaxis and periodontal maintenance 
  • Conduct periodontal charting and assessments 
  • Take diagnostic radiographs 
  • Deliver patient education and oral hygiene instruction 
  • Identify and communicate treatment needs to patients and providers 
  • Maintain accurate clinical documentation 
  • Support comprehensive patient care through collaboration with dentists and team members 
  • Promote preventive dentistry and long-term oral health
